Supported by the Denodo Platform, Chick-fil-A can now deliver menu information to franchise partners as a data service. The Denodo Platform also integrates historical pricing data, along with competitive pricing and location data, for price-based-marketing. The Denodo Platform, which uses data virtualization to integrate information on outlet location coordinates and data on competitor locations, enables full-featured location-based services. And when Chick-fil-A needed to provide its partners with real-time organizational data, the company leveraged the Denodo Platform. In 2022 Chick-fil-A reported $4.5B in revenue.įounded as a family business in 1946, Chick-fil-A has grown to become the largest quick-service chicken restaurant chain in the United States. They have more than 2800 restaurants, primarily in the United States, and is known as one of the most successful restaurant chains. Chick-Fil-A is a quick-service chicken restaurant chain, headquartered in College Park, Georgia. ![]()
